Management Meeting Minutes — Hallvik Term Sheet

Attendees: regional leads, counsel. Reviewed Hallvik Group's revised term sheet. Exclusivity window shortened to nine months; revenue share now tiered. Counsel flagged the termination clause; redline due Friday. Branch managers: do not discuss terms externally. Decision targeted for next session. Marten to circulate comparison memo. One confidential item was recorded for the file.

management briefing: Project Ulavan slips by two quarters because of the staffing delay.

Hi Tove — quick wrap-up on the Meadowfell profile-store cut-over. We finished sharding last night: sixteen shards, consistent hashing on user handle, old monolith now read-only. No auth paths changed, but please eyeball the new replication setup. The shard router's production settings, as deployed, are pasted below for your review.

deployment values, yadug-bawif:
[framir]
team = pelox
access_code = ac_a38ab2
owner = tamion.julael
host = framir.tolvaqlabs.test
port = 11211
peer = tammir.zemvargrid.local
salt = 2215ef03
pin = 1541

The breaker opens after 12 consecutive 5xx responses within a 60-second window and stays open for five minutes before half-open probing resumes. During the open state, Lanternfall serves cached pricing data, so customer impact is limited to stale quotes. This fired three times last week, all during Fernwick's maintenance window, so we're considering suppressing alerts during that period. Thresholds and recent trip history can be reviewed on the breaker status page.

operations page: https://jenkins.zemvarcloud.local/job/merge_requests/repo/build/73930b4b30f0a8ed

Handover note — Mira to Dolan

Branch managers, quick context while I'm away: the Verlast plant capacity question is still open. We've maxed out the two lines in Kettleport, and demand for the Arbon series keeps climbing. Dolan will take the final call on whether we add a third shift or lease space at the Granmoor site. Don't promise customers faster lead times until he confirms. Costings are in the shared folder. Before briefing your teams, read the note below carefully.

internal memo for kawip-hadug: Headcount on the Wenwyn team goes from 7 to 140 by the end of January. Gross margin on Wenwyn came in at 20 percent against a plan of 15 percent.